The written survey questionnaire was filled in by a representative sample of 85 service users who had all recently received treatment at the practice.
In terms of responses to questions there was a 100% positive response rate to the quality of care received at the practice. All respondents reported care as being either outstanding or good. Patients were asked why they had chosen the practice and over 75% of patients stated that they had chosen the practice based on its reputation. Around 70% of patients had not visited the practice website - www.langleydentalpractice.com so we need to make sure that the Dr Tariq Drabu affair and media department gets focused on targeting our online message as widely as possible to as many current and potential service users as it can. I will set this as an important priority for us.
Over 80% of patients asked were able to get an appointment at a time and date that was convenient to them with the vast majority of appointments being made over the telephone. Around the same number strongly agreed that their appointment was given within a reasonable timeframe, with 100% of respondents either agreeing or strongly agreeing that the person who booked their appointment at the reception was courteous and helpful.
On the day of their appointment all patients either agreed or strongly agreed that they were made to feel welcome at the practice and felt that the reception and waiting area was clean and pleasant. 90% of respondents were seen on time or within 5 minutes of their appointed time. All respondents felt that they were treated with respect by the dental nurse and the dentist with 90% strongly agreeing that the dentist had been kind and considerate. All respondents felt that they had understood what was being proposed with 75% understanding their charges.
